Economy Lines: Best Value for Most Buyers

Economy shipping lines offer the best cost-to-reliability ratio for most W2C buyers. YunExpress is consistently rated as one of the safest options for customs, with competitive pricing and decent tracking. It's the go-to recommendation for buyers in the US, UK, Australia, and most of Europe.

Other popular economy options include PostNL (excellent for Netherlands and surrounding countries), Yanwen (good for US buyers with lower customs risk), and various branded lines that SugarGoo offers under their own label. Economy lines typically cost $8-20 for a standard haul and take 15-25 days.

The trade-off with economy lines is tracking quality — updates can be sparse, especially once the package leaves China. This is normal and not a cause for concern unless the package has been stuck at the same status for more than 2 weeks.

Express Lines: When Speed Matters

DHL, UPS, and FedEx express services offer the fastest delivery (5-10 days) but come with higher costs ($30-60+) and significantly higher customs scrutiny. Express carriers are required to provide detailed customs declarations, which increases the chance of inspection and potential seizure.

Express lines are best used for time-sensitive items, lower-value purchases where customs risk is minimal, or when you're willing to pay a premium for speed and reliable tracking. Many experienced buyers use express for accessories and clothing but stick to economy for shoes and higher-value items.

Some SugarGoo-branded express lines offer a middle ground — faster than economy but with better customs handling than standard DHL/UPS. These are worth considering if they're available for your destination.

Country-Specific Recommendations

Shipping line performance varies significantly by destination country:

  • USA: YunExpress, Yanwen, or SugarGoo's own lines are community favorites. Avoid DHL for high-value hauls.
  • UK: YunExpress and PostNL perform well. Post-Brexit customs can be strict — declare conservatively.
  • Australia: YunExpress is the top recommendation. Australia Post integration provides good tracking.
  • Germany: PostNL and YunExpress work well. German customs can be thorough — split large hauls.
  • Canada: YunExpress and EMS are reliable. CBSA can be unpredictable — keep individual package values low.
  • Brazil: Shipping to Brazil is challenging. Use economy lines and expect longer delays and potential customs fees.
  • Southeast Asia: Most lines work well. Local postal integration is generally smooth.
